WebFeb 22, 2024 · Most ovarian cysts are small and don't cause symptoms. If a cyst does cause symptoms, you may have pressure, bloating, swelling, or pain in the lower abdomen on the side of the cyst. This pain may be … WebDr. Jeff Livingston answered.
